COVID2019 и это вот все. Друзья, вся эта история начинает плохо пахнет. Мойте руки, не ходите в люди. Отложите все плановые покупки и положите в носок заначку. Заприте ваших родителей, бабушек-дедушек на даче. Лучше перебдеть чем недобдеть. Берегите себя!

Проблема с исчезновением товаров из корзины


SergeyMA

Recommended Posts

Здравствуйте!

У меня opencartpro 2.3.0.2
Возникла следующая проблема при работе сайта.
Многие клиенты начали жаловаться, что при формировании больших заказов (по количеству товаров) исчезают товары из корзины.
Например, собирает клиент заказ из ста позиций на 15 тыс. рублей, потом раз, смотрит, а в корзине осталось 60 позиций на 10 тыс. руб. А через какое-то время еще меньше, и еще. Клиенты как зарегистрированные, так и незарегистрированные, как с компьютера, так и с мобильных устройств.

 

При этом ошибок в журнале ошибок нет совсем.
Права на папку system/library/cache стоят 777.
Кэш чистил и обновлял.

Время корзины увеличено с 1 часа до 1 недели.

php_value_max_input_vars 10000.

Техподдержка хостера пишет, что в серверных логах ошибок нет

 

Очень напрягает то, что нет ошибок и непонятно что это.

Кто-нибудь сталкивался с подобным?

Ссылка на комментарий
Поделиться на других сайтах

В 08.02.2019 at 19:26, BuslikDrev сказал:

Где меняли время корзины?
Здесь?

 

Да, здесь.

В 10.02.2019 at 17:08, Yoda сказал:

Попробуйте перевести сессии в memcache или redis

А также настройте само время жизни сессии в  неделю

Спасибо, попробую.

 

И выскочили некоторые ошибки, когда был большой наплыв посетителей на сайт,например:

2019-02-11 21:21:26 - PHP Warning:  filesize(): stat failed for/var/www//data/www/.ru/system/storage/cache/cache.article.total.1.0.1.9ad218453f833c1f2c56dc4a018ae03d.1549912882 in /var/www//data/www/.ru/system/library/cache/file.php on line 37

2019-02-11 21:21:26 - PHP Warning:  fread() expects parameter 1 to be resource, boolean given in /var/www//data/www/.ru/system/library/cache/file.php on line 37

2019-02-11 21:21:26 - PHP Warning:  flock() expects parameter 1 to be resource, boolean given in /var/www//data/www/.ru/system/library/cache/file.php on line 39

2019-02-11 21:21:26 - PHP Warning:  fclose() expects parameter 1 to be resource, boolean given in /var/www//data/www/.ru/system/library/cache/file.php on line 41

2019-02-12 7:07:57 - PHP Warning:  unlink(/var/www//data/www/.ru/system/storage/cache/cache.article.total.1.0.1.fe25175129461e57e31dedaf0534c733.1549948068): No such file or directory in /var/www//data/www/.ru/system/library/cache/file.php on line 73

 

Но как я понимаю это немного не то.

 

Ссылка на комментарий
Поделиться на других сайтах

Попробуйте
 

Скрытый текст

system/library/session.php

Найти:
ini_get('session.cookie_lifetime'),

Заменить на:
(ini_get('session.cookie_lifetime') ? (time() + ini_get('session.cookie_lifetime')) : 0),
 

 

Ссылка на комментарий
Поделиться на других сайтах

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Гость
Ответить в тему...

×   Вы вставили отформатированное содержимое.   Удалить форматирование

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• Сейчас на странице   0 пользователей

    • Нет пользователей, просматривающих эту страницу